NTA confirms need for later Dingle-Killarney local link service

 

The National Transport Authority says it has identified a need for a later service on the Dingle-Killarney local link route.

The information was provided at the recent meeting of the Castleisland-Corca Dhuibhne Municipal District.

At the previous meeting Cllr Tommy Griffin tabled a motion seeking additional evening services on the 276-bus route, in both directions.

In response to a letter from councillors, the NTA confirmed that the need for a later service has been identified.

It added the timetable implementation of this service is subject to availability of resources, and it is in discussion with the Department of Transport on PSO (Public Service Obligation) funding.
